If you keep doing what you are doing, you will not only "make trouble in your YouTube channel", but your channel will be banned. Under YouTube's Terms of Use, once you have had a channel terminated, you are not allowed to create, use or possess any other YouTube channel.
You have created a channel using content you taped off of television. You did not clear the rights to the content you used with either the football clubs in question, or the TV networks you taped the content from. In addition you didn't clear publicity rights with the football players or commentators who appear in your videos.
In short, you have done everything wrong possible for a channel like yours where the YouTube Rules are concerned. It would be much better if you took every one of those videos down, and started all over again.

From the YouTube Help section
"Can I monetize my video if I made a recording from TV, DVD or CD?
"Although you may have recorded something yourself, the actual creator or author of the underlying content being recorded (e.g. producer of the TV show being displayed on the TV) may hold many of the rights needed to commercially exploit this content.
If you want to monetise your recording of a TV show, DVD or CD, you would need to get explicit written permission from the applicable rights owner of the audio and/or visual elements that you recorded." "
